What Is Polished Plaster?
Polished plaster is a traditional Italian wall finish crafted from slaked lime and fine marble dust. Our team applies it by hand in multiple thin layers, building up a smooth, luminous surface with natural depth and variation. Unlike paint or wallpaper, polished plaster develops a genuine reflective quality — the result of careful burnishing with a stainless steel trowel.
Furthermore, polished plaster is naturally breathable, mineral-based, and free from synthetic resins or acrylics. Because it bonds directly with the wall substrate, it resists cracking, peeling, and fading over time. Applied correctly by our team, it lasts 20 to 30 years or more.

What Affects the Cost of Polished Plaster?
Surface Preparation
The condition of your walls before our team begins application has a direct impact on the final cost. Skimming, crack repair, or wallpaper removal all add time and material requirements to the project.
Finish Type
High-gloss Lucidato and metallic effects require more coats and greater specialist skill than a standard Marmorino finish. Consequently, the finish type chosen is the single biggest factor in determining your overall cost.
Number of Coats
Our team applies between two and five coats depending on the desired depth and finish type. Specifically, metallic and mirror effects need the most layers to achieve their signature quality.
Room Size & Access
High ceilings, tight corners, and detailed architectural features increase both labour time and complexity. In addition, any scaffolding requirements for tall spaces are factored into your written quote upfront.
Location
Labour rates vary between Bristol, Bath, Cardiff, and London projects. However, all our quotes include travel costs and carry no hidden charges.
Protective Sealing
Wax, resin, or hydrophobic sealers significantly extend the life of the finish and are included in our final application stage. Moreover, sealing is essential in bathrooms, kitchens, and other high-moisture environments.

Polished Plaster Materials & Durability
Polished plaster consists of slaked lime combined with fine marble dust or natural marble aggregates. Our team uses no synthetic resins or acrylics — making it a naturally breathable, mineral finish. In addition, Valpaint polished plasters include specialist pigments to enhance colour depth and long-term consistency.
When our team applies polished plaster correctly, it lasts 20 to 30 years or more without peeling, cracking, or fading under normal conditions. However, surfaces in bathrooms or high-traffic areas benefit from periodic maintenance and re-sealing to preserve the full quality of the finish.

Choosing the Right Polished Plaster Finish
Polished plaster and Venetian plaster are closely related Italian lime-based finishes, and many specialists use the terms interchangeably. In general, “Venetian plaster” refers to the broader category of hand-applied Italian lime finishes, while “polished plaster” describes higher-gloss, more reflective variants such as Lucidato and Marmorino.
